Tarjetas de memoria: Paradigmes algorithmiques et stratégies efficaces — 24 tarjetas

Todas las tarjetas

1Pregunta

Paradigme glouton — objectif ?

Respuesta

Construire une solution en choisissant localement optimal.

2Pregunta

Diviser-pour-régner — principe ?

Respuesta

Décomposer en sous-problèmes, résoudre, puis combiner.

3Pregunta

Programmation dynamique — propriété clé ?

Respuesta

Sous-structure optimale et sous-problèmes chevauchants.

4Pregunta

Force brute — méthode ?

Respuesta

Tester toutes les possibilités jusqu’à la solution.

5Pregunta

Stratégie gloutonne — propriété du choix ?

Respuesta

Choix local optimal, pas toujours globalement optimal.

6Pregunta

Mémoïsation — rôle ?

Respuesta

Stocker résultats pour éviter recalculs en top-down.

7Pregunta

Tabulation — rôle ?

Respuesta

Remplir un tableau de façon itérative pour résoudre.

8Pregunta

Diviser pour mieux régner — analyse ?

Respuesta

Décomposition en sous-problèmes indépendants, complexité typique O(n log n).

9Pregunta

Force brute — limite ?

Respuesta

Complexité exponentielle, impraticable pour grandes instances.

10Pregunta

Retour sur trace — mécanisme ?

Respuesta

Explorer arbre, revenir en arrière si branche non optimale.

11Pregunta

Heuristiques — rôle ?

Respuesta

Guider la recherche sans garantie d’optimalité.

12Pregunta

Métaheuristiques — définition ?

Respuesta

Algorithmes généraux pour optimisation approximative.

13Pregunta

Comparaison paradigmes — optimalité ?

Respuesta

Force brute garantie, glouton conditionnelle, DP garantie si propriété du sous-problème.

14Pregunta

Dijkstra — complexité ?

Respuesta

O((V + E) log V) avec tas, dépend du graphe.

15Pregunta

Sac à dos fractionnaire — stratégie ?

Respuesta

Prendre objets selon ratio valeur/poids, solution optimale.

16Pregunta

Sac à dos 0-1 — approche ?

Respuesta

Utiliser programmation dynamique pour optimalité.

17Pregunta

Fibonacci naïf — complexité ?

Respuesta

Exponentielle, beaucoup de recalculs.

18Pregunta

Fibonacci DP — avantage ?

Respuesta

Réduction de la complexité à O(n) en évitant recalculs.

19Pregunta

Validation DaariNova — principe ?

Respuesta

Identifier propriété du choix et sous-structure pour garantir optimalité.

20Pregunta

Force brute — limite pratique ?

Respuesta

Intractable pour instances de taille moyenne ou grande.

21Pregunta

Glouton — condition d’optimalité ?

Respuesta

Propriété du choix glouton vérifiée et sous-structure optimale.

22Pregunta

Programmation dynamique — avantage ?

Respuesta

Solution efficace pour problèmes avec sous-structure et chevauchement.

23Pregunta

Dijkstra — principe ?

Respuesta

Fixer distances minimales en élargissant le plus proche sommet.

24Pregunta

Heuristique du plus proche voisin — application ?

Respuesta

TSP, choisit la ville la plus proche non visitée.

Ponte a prueba con el cuestionario

Pon a prueba tus conocimientos con 24 preguntas sobre Paradigmes algorithmiques et stratégies efficaces.

1. Quelles propriétés rendent la programmation dynamique applicable ?

2. Quelle différence fondamentale sépare la mémoïsation de la tabulation ?

Realiza el cuestionario →

Lee la hoja de repaso

Revisa el curso completo en la hoja de repaso para Paradigmes algorithmiques et stratégies efficaces.

Ver hoja de repaso →

Similar courses

Crea tus propias tarjetas de memoria

Importa tu curso y la IA genera tarjetas de memoria en 30 segundos.

Generador de tarjetas de memoria